What is a xanthene dye?

A xanthene dye is a fluorescent yellow, blue or red dye, chiefly used in dyeing textile fibres, colouring paper, or producing fluorescent effects.

What is the name of the Fluorescent red dye resulting from bromine on fluorescein?

The name of the fluorescent red dye is eosin


What is a calcein?

a calcein is a fluorescent dye, used in some cases as a calcium indicator.
